    We bought the meet & greet package and it was great for my kids to be able to meet the idols. If I were to say anything negative, I think getting there 30 minutes prior to the show would have been fine. It said on the ticket to come 1 hour early. It was pretty hot that day and it was a bit of a long sit. The zoo was smart to bring out animals for the children to see 30 minutes prior to the show though....it definitely helped to pass the time. Another thing is that the show that they put on was pretty short. Not sure how they could make it longer, but to sit for 1 hour before the show to watch about 20-30 minute show seemed a little skimpy. I'm only pointing out the negatives, more for suggestions but overall, a great experience!
